Are felpro gaskets fine for replacing head & intake gaskets? With all the talk about bad factory gaskets, I don't want too have to do this more than one time! My 2000 LS has acquired the dreaded antifreeze leak. Not sure yet if it's the intake or the head gasket though. (starts leaking shortly after starting -mostly from off the starter- then quits after engine fully warms up & starts leaking again as engine cools off) I have not had the time to crawl around under the hood yet to see. Also I saw felpro has a severe use head gasket #510SD is it worth the extra money?

When I did my lower intake manifold because of the coolant leak, I used Felpro. It came with everything needed for the upper plenum. Got it at NAPA. It was a 38 dollar kit. I don't know anything about the head gasket Felpro makes.
